Output ecc868c0b65aa03012640260c77a99db863f6a6210251911e1255de1446075e7:1

value
3749240
script pubkey
OP_0 OP_PUSHBYTES_20 341da60be26d5cad7038a2d5f40077d4830f5576
address
ltc1qxsw6vzlzd4w26upc5t2lgqrh6jps74tksjtfze
transaction
ecc868c0b65aa03012640260c77a99db863f6a6210251911e1255de1446075e7
spent
true